Smooth Operator
A wide handlebar, low seat height and confidence-inspiring riding position have been engineered for comfort with a gentle sports bias. Together, they help the rider make the most of the agile chassis and stay connected to the machine. With a 24-degree rake angle and 106 mm of trail, the Interceptor 650 feels nimble in the city, planted on the highways and confident on the twisties.
At the heart of it
The Interceptor 650 marks the return of Royal Enfield’s legendary parallel twin-cylinder engine. Backed with an air/oil-cooled parallel twin configuration, the 648cc engine offers 47 horsepower at 7150 RPM and a maximum of 52 Nm torque at 5250 RPM. A smooth throttle response throughout the rev range ensures sufficient power to make light work of city traffic or cruise effortlessly along the open roads.
| ENGINE TYPE | 4 stroke, single overhead cam, air-oil cooled, parallel twin |
| DISPLACEMENT | 648cc |
| BORE X STROKE | 78 mm x 67.8 mm |
| COMPRESSION RATION | 9.5:1 |
| RATED OUTPUT | 47 bhp @ 7100 rpm |
| MAX. TORQUE | 52 Nm @ 4000 rpm |
| LUBRICATION | Wet Sump |
| FUEL SUPPL | Fuel Injection |
| EXHAUST SYSTEM | Euro 4 Compliant |
| CERTIFICATION | Euro 5 |
| GEARBOX | 6 Speed |
| FINAL DRIVE | Chain |
| IGNITION | Digital Spark ignition - TCI |
| COOLING SYSTEM | Air/Oil Cooled |
| BATTERY | 12V |
| STARTING | Electric |
| FRAME | Steel tubular, double cradle frame |
| FRONT SUSPENSION | 41 mm front fork |
| FRONT SUSPENSION STROKE | 110mm |
| FRONT BRAKE | 320mm Disc ABS |
| REAR SUSPENSION | Twin coil-over shocks |
| REAR SUSPENSION STROKE | 88mm |
| REAR BRAKE | 240mm Disc ABS |
| FRONT RIM TYPE | Spoked |
| REAR RIM TYPE | Spoked |
| REAR RIM DIMENSION | 18 in |
| FRONT TYRE | 100/90-18 |
| REAR TYRE | 130/70-18 |
| HEADLIGHT LAMP | N/A |
| TAILLIGHT LAMP | N/A |
| LENGTH | 2122mm |
| WIDTH | 789mm |
| HEIGHT | 1165mm |
| GROUND CLEARANCE | 174mm |
| UNLADEN WEIGHT | 202kg |
| PERMITTED TOTAL WEIGHT | 200kg |
| USABABLE TANK VOLUME | 13.7 Ltr |
| SEAT HEIGHT | 804mm |
